Read moreThrough my own journey of understanding dopamine, I realized that many common behaviors—like endless scrolling through social media or consuming sugary snacks—actually hijack our brain's motivational system. Dopamine isn't merely about feeling good; it signals importance to the brain, pushing us to repeat actions. When dopamine becomes linked to instant rewards like notifications or drama, it creates a loop that erodes focus, weakens willpower, and distorts reality over time. The dopamine loop consists of cues that trigger cravings, responses to satisfy those cravings, and rewards that reinforce the behavior. Unfortunately, this loop often leads to tolerance, requiring more stimulation to feel the same motivation. I found that addressing this requires intentional steps to reset the nervous system and dopamine patterns. Reducing sensory input from digital devices or highly stimulating environments lowers constant dopamine surges, allowing the brain to recalibrate. Physical movement is another key element; daily exercise helped me boost natural dopamine production beneficially, without dependency on instant gratification. Building discipline through mindful activities—like meditation or skill mastery—strengthens prefrontal cortex functions that regulate impulses and focus. Protecting sleep quality is crucial too, as restful sleep supports dopamine receptor regeneration and emotional stability. When I prioritized consistent sleep schedules, my mental clarity and motivation improved significantly. If you feel trapped by distractions or emotional highs and lows, consider a dopamine detox to reclaim control. Resetting dopamine doesn’t mean eliminating pleasure but learning to engage with it healthily. The process is gradual and requires patience, but the benefits touch every aspect of mental and physical well-being. For those interested, exploring nervous system healing techniques and understanding dopamine’s role in shaping habits can deepen recovery.
